MySQL怎样有效管理大字段存储(mysql大字段存储)
2023-06-13 09:13:36 时间
MySQL是目前使用非常普遍的关系型数据库,它的功能和性能满足了众多的开发人员的需求。 当处理大字段存储时,MySQL可以在给定表中使大字段存储如图片、文档等信息变得更有效。
首先,最简单有效的方式是MySQL中使用VARCHAR字段类型来存储大数据。这一功能类型提供params指定数据的最大大小,最大可达65535字节,如下SQL语句所示:
CREATE TABLE `data` (`id` INT NOT NULL AUTO_INCREMENT,`third_party_data` VARCHAR(65535) NOT NULL, PRIMARY KEY (`id`));
当字段大小超出了VARCHAR的限制时,MySQL可以使用TEXT和BLOB字段类型来存储大字段数据。TEXT类型的最大容量可达2^16-1(65535)字节,BLOB类型的最大容量可达2^24-1(16MB)字节。下面是使用TEXT和BLOB类型存储数据的SQL语句:
CREATE TABLE `data` (`id` INT NOT NULL AUTO_INCREMENT,`third_party_data` TEXT NOT NULL, `third_party_data2` blob NOT NULL, PRIMARY KEY (`id`));
此外,MySQL也提供了另一种更加灵活的方式来有效管理大字段。MySQL中有两种方法可以让开发者将大数据存储用独立的表中,然后通过外键引用。第一种方法是使用“Fulltext”搜索,它可以搜索包含在大文本中的单词和短语;第二种方法是使用MySQL的特殊操作符“`- `”,它可以将大字段分割成一系列的json字段,并以此作为独立表的一部分存储。
CREATE TABLE `data` (`id` INT NOT NULL AUTO_INCREMENT,`third_party_data` JSON NOT NULL, PRIMARY KEY (`id`));
因此,MySQL可以有效地保存大字段数据。此外,更好的方式是尝试灵活地组合以上提到的方法,而不是一概而论地使用MySQL来处理大数据空间。根据具体需求,可以采取合理的方法予以尊重。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 MySQL怎样有效管理大字段存储(mysql大字段存储)
相关文章
- 【MySQL高级】Mysql复制及Mysql权限管理
- MySQL图标:让数据库管理变得更有趣(mysql图标)
- 管理MySQL多行数据操作指南(mysql多行数据)
- 库管理MySQL用户权限与数据库管理策略(mysql用户与数据)
- 文件MySQL配置之路:.cnf 文件解析(mysql.cnf)
- 解决MySQL实现最高隔离级别(修改mysql的隔离级别)
- MySQL储存方式:简单、快速、可靠(mysql的存储方式)
- C语言操作MySQL:从零开始(c语言连接mysql)
- MySQL函数调用:快速上手指南(mysql函数调用)
- 件MySQL中间件:提高数据性能的有效工具(mysql中间)
- 机制MySQL存储过程锁定机制:保护数据安全(mysql存储过程锁)
- MySQL数据库中的数据冗余管理(mysql数据冗余)
- MySQL中安全存储二进制数据(mysql二进制数据)
- MySQL数据库导出教程,详细介绍数据库导出的步骤。(mysql数据库导出步骤)
- 深入解析MySQL中bit类型数据的使用方法(mysql中bit的用法)
- MySQL配置实现CAS认证(cas mysql配置)
- 宇宙中的开放数据基于Apollo和MySQL的实现(apollo mysql)
- 实现集群用4台MySQL服务器做数据同步(4台mysql实现同步)
- CMD快捷导入MySQL数据表(cmd导入mysql表)
- MySQL数据库的三大范式简介(mysql三大范式简述)
- MySQL的Year用法详解轻松提取年份信息(mysql year使用)
- MySQL数据库无需使用表空间,灵活管理存储空间(mysql不使用表空间)
- MySQL免费版下载,专业数据库管理好帮手(mysql下载免费版)
- 技术分享MySQL实现两次查询结果数值相加(mysql 两次查询相加)
- MySQL无法存储中文字符(mysql不能存汉子)